Julien Olivain
3ce11070cb
package/xfsprogs: bump version to 6.18.0
...
Changelog:
https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/fs/xfs/xfsprogs-dev.git/tree/doc/CHANGES?h=v6.18.0
This commit refreshes the patch 0001 (rebase and update upstream link
to lore mailing list). It also removes the patch 0002 included in
this new version and removes the corresponding _AUTORECONF and
_POST_CONFIGURE_HOOKS.
Also, the upstream commit [1] introduced a usage of the "capacity"
field of zoned block devices, introduced in Kernel commit [2],
first included in v5.9. For this reason, this commit adds the new
dependency to BR2_TOOLCHAIN_HEADERS_AT_LEAST_5_9.
For that reason, this commit updates the test_xfsprogs runtime test
to switch to a Bootlin external toolchain, which includes Kernel
headers that meet this new requirement.
Finally, this commit also updates this runtime test Kernel version
to the LTS 6.18.9. This is because the default filesystem options
of mkfs.xfs were updated in upstream commit [3] to include new
features supported in the new Kernel 6.18.y LTS series. The commit [3]
is included in xfsprogs v6.18.

Yann E. MORIN
f9cdca48a5
docs/manual: use space-separated list for BR2_EXTERNAL
...
Specifying a list of br2-external trees is poorly documented, and the
only example uses a colon to separate the br2-external paths.
Adding the support for colon-separated list is the biggest mistake that
was made when introducing support for multiple br2-external [0]. Indeed,
both space and colon can be used to separate entries in the list, and it
is also possible to mix the two. However, internally, the list is stored
as a space-separated list, and all the code will split on spaces.
Besides, all other lists in Buildroot are a space-separated:
BR2_ROOTFS_DEVICE_TABLE
BR2_ROOTFS_STATIC_DEVICE_TABLE
BR2_TARGET_TZ_ZONELIST
BR2_ROOTFS_USERS_TABLES
BR2_ROOTFS_OVERLAY
BR2_ROOTFS_PRE_BUILD_SCRIPT
BR2_ROOTFS_POST_BUILD_SCRIPT
BR2_ROOTFS_POST_FAKEROOT_SCRIPT
BR2_ROOTFS_POST_IMAGE_SCRIPT
...
So, using colons is odd.
The fact that BR2_EXTERNAL is passed on the command line rather than
being a Kconfig item is not a reason enough to justify that it be
colon-separated.
Change the documentation to only mention using a space-separated list.
Of course, for backward compatibility, we keep the code as-is to accept
a colon-separated list, but we just do not advertise it.
Note that keeping the split on colons means that colons are not accepted
in pathnames of br2-external trees; in practice, this is not a new
restriction, or one that could lift as usign colons in Makefiles are
problematic anyway.

Yann E. MORIN
244e4283a9
support/br2-external: remove leftover trap
...
The trap was initially introduced in c5fa9308ea (core/br2-external:
properly report unexpected errors), in 2017, to catch all unexpected
errors, back when a single file was generated, and errors emitted to
stderr.
Since commit d027cd75d0 (core: generate all br2-external files in
one go), in 2019 the single output file 'ofile' is no longer created,
as multiple output files were then introduced, while messages for
*expected errors* were redirected to a Makefile variable assignment
emitted on stdout, at which point the script just exits (in error);
expected failures only occur in do_validate().
Unexpected errors can only occur on failure to create, or write to,
output files, either '.br2-external.mk' in do_validate() or do_mk(),
or any of the kconfig fragments in do_kconfig(). Cause for failure to
create those can only be a no-space-left-on-device condition, as they
are created in a directory that was just created by the script earlier
in main(), and thus has the necessary mode; failure to create that
directory is now caught explicitly.
A trap on ERR is not called when the shell exits explicitly with a call
to 'exit', thus, only failures to create or write to output file would
be caught. In that case, we are better off not trying to write to those
files anyway: failure to create the file would already be reported by
the shell on stderr, while disk-full would not allow to store the output
anyway...
In any case, the script exits in error, which is going to be caught by
the caller, which will terminate.
So, drop the trap altogether.
As a side effect, that squelches a shellcheck error.

Julien Olivain
3dbb2a0aaa
arch/arm: add the Neoverse-V3AE core
...
This commit adds the Neoverse-V3AE (Automotive Enhanced) core, which
is an armv9.2a ISA. See: [1] [2].
This CPU support was added in GCC 15. See [3] [4] [5].
This CPU supports Aarch64 only at all exception levels (EL0 to EL3).
This CPU is present in NVIDIA Jetson Thor / Tegra T264 [6].
Note: at the time of this commit, the latest binutils v2.46 does not
include a Neoverse-V3AE support for its '-mcpu' option. See [7]. This is
not an issue because gcc will call the "as" assembler with the relevant
"-march=armv9.2-a+EXTENSION..." options. Binutils supports "armv9.2-a"
since upstream commit [8] (first included in 2.38), and the oldest
Binutils version in Buildroot is 2.44.

Julien Olivain
efe7aa7ca4
arch/arm: add the Neoverse-V2 core
...
This commit adds the Neoverse-V2 core, which is an armv9.0a ISA.
See: [1] [2].
This CPU support was added in GCC 13. See [3] [4] [5].
This CPU supports Aarch64 at all exception levels (EL0 to EL3).
It also supports Aarch32 only in EL0 (user-space). This means it's
technically possible to compile Aarch32 code. GCC has the support
to do so. Since Buildroot recompiles a full system (ATF, Kernel,
user-space) this support has limited value. This is why this
CPU is limited to 64bit builds only.
Note: at the time of this commit, the latest binutils v2.46 does not
include a Neoverse-V2 support for its '-mcpu' option. See [6]. This is
not an issue because gcc will call the "as" assembler with the relevant
"-march=armv9-a+EXTENSION..." options. Binutils supports "armv9-a"
since upstream commit [7] (first included in 2.38), and the oldest
Binutils version in Buildroot is 2.44.
